Since 1923, Herman Miller has been guided by a commitment to problem-solving designs that inspire the best in people. Along the way, Herman Miller has forged critical relationships with the most visionary designers of the day, from mid-century greats like George Nelson, the Eames Office, and Isamu Noguchi; to research-oriented visionaries like Robert Propst and Bill Stumpf. Herman Miller has spent the last century pioneering original, timeless design that makes an enduring impactand in 2020, the company harnessed its legacy of turning insights into solutions by launching Herman Miller Gaming, which delivers the world's best gaming products uniquely designed to unlock every player's full potential.

Founded in 1996, Four Hands manufactures and distributes home furnishing products. The company offers tables, beds, doors, windows, and other wood furniture. Four Hands markets its products to furniture stores, large retailers, lighting showrooms, interior designers, and individual customers worldwide. The company is headquartered in Austin, Texas.
